What is the Urgency?
AI is evolving rapidly, much like other transformational technologies in their early years. For perspective, consider the introduction of spreadsheets in the late 70s. For finance analysts accustomed to calculators and ledgers, spreadsheets were revolutionary: they automated calculations, enabled live "what-if" scenarios, and transformed industries overnight. AI holds similar potential. Approaching it with this mindset can help you and your organization move forward confidently. Finance professionals who resisted spreadsheets were quickly left behind—AI is no different.

Challenges of Implementing AI in Technology Businesses
While the potential of AI is immense, integrating it into a technology business comes with its own set of challenges. Understanding these obstacles is crucial for entrepreneurs who wish to leverage AI effectively.
1. Knowledge Gap
Many businesses struggle with a knowledge gap regarding AI technologies. This includes a lack of understanding of how AI functions, its benefits, and how to implement it effectively. Training and workshops can help bridge this gap, but entrepreneurs must prioritize continuous learning.
2. Resource Allocation
Implementing AI solutions often requires significant investment in both time and money. Entrepreneurs must assess their budgets and resources carefully. This may mean reallocating funds from other projects or scaling back certain initiatives to make room for AI integration.
3. Resistance to Change
Human nature often resists change. Employees may feel threatened by the introduction of AI, fearing job loss or a shift in their roles. It’s critical for leaders to communicate the benefits of AI and how it can empower employees rather than replace them.
4. Data Privacy and Security
As AI systems often require large amounts of data, concerns about data privacy and security are paramount. Entrepreneurs must ensure that robust data governance practices are in place to protect customer information and comply with regulations.
5. Integration with Existing Systems
Integrating AI into existing systems can be complex. Businesses may need to invest in new infrastructure or software to ensure compatibility. Successful integration requires a well-structured plan and often a phased approach to minimize disruptions.
Strategies for Successful AI Adoption
To navigate the challenges of AI implementation, entrepreneurs can adopt several strategies:
- Invest in Education: Regular training sessions and educational resources can help employees understand AI's potential and applications.
- Pilot Programs: Start with small-scale pilot projects to test AI solutions before full-scale implementation.
- Foster a Culture of Innovation: Encourage a workplace culture that embraces change and innovation, allowing employees to feel comfortable experimenting with new technologies.
- Collaborate with Experts: Partnering with AI experts or consultants can provide valuable insights and guidance throughout the integration process.
- Monitor Progress: Continuously assess the effectiveness of AI initiatives and be prepared to adjust strategies as needed.
